Also, the universe has an objective means of determining Good and Evil, that is, the detection spells. If we had an objective way of, say, determining who's going to be a dick and who isn't from birth, the world would be totally different.

Does is? I've always taken detect evil to detect "supernatural" evil, demons etc. rather then human villains.

Nope it detects a person's alignment too.

Though more accurately it detects how much "Goodness" and "Evil" you attract to your make up (Hence why many beings flat out get false readings like most of the undead)

But many settings have loathed this aspect and have gone out of their way to just outright say "no detect alignment"... which is something I fully support.

No really... They could remove methods to detect alignment from the main game too and I'd be in full support.

Since dungeons and dragons can NEVER decide if the alignments are cartoons, realistic, or to be ignored... Removing detect alignment would instantly fix it.
